Peel Regional Police have confirmed three teenage siblings are the victims of a deadly crash in Brampton on Saturday.
Officers responded to the area of Conestoga Drive and Elmvale Avenue, north of Sandalwood Parkway, around 2 a.m. after a vehicle struck a tree.
Emergency crews say the vehicle was engulfed in flames upon arrival. The three occupants inside the vehicle were all pronounced dead on scene.
On Monday, police confirmed the victims were siblings aged 16, 17, and 19. The names of the deceased have not been released.

There is still no word on the cause of the crash.
The investigation is ongoing.
